Abstract
[ScCl2{N(SiMe3)(2)}(THF)(2)] (1) has been prepared by the reaction of [ScCl 3(THF)(3)] with the trisamide SC[N(SiMe3)(2)](3) in tetrahydrofurane soluti on forming colourless moisture sensitive crystals, which were characterized by a crystal structure determination. Space group P (1) over bar, Z = 2, l attice dimensions at -50 degrees C: a = 841.4(1), b = 924.2(1), c = 1550.0( 1) pm, alpha = 90.046(7)degrees, beta = 95.671(9)degrees, gamma = 106.066(6 )degrees, R-1 = 0.0329. In the molecular structure of 1 the scandium atom h as a distorted trigonal-bipyramidal coordination with the THF molecules in apical positions. At 400 degrees C 1 is converted into scandium nitride, Sc N, by stepwise leaving of THF and ClSiMe3.
